As the Manager of the Project Engineering team in the Direct Sales Office, this position manages the after-sale delivery of equipment products, accessories, and services sold by the DSO. Oversees estimating, submittal, order entry, release, delivery, and financial elements of customer orders. Works closely with the Branch or District Sales Managers in coordinating the project management, project costing and order management functions.

What you will do:

  • Selects, leads, directs, evaluates, and develops a team of project engineers to ensure that projects are completed on-time, within budget, and according to project specifications.
  • Prioritizes tasks and assigns team members to multiple engineering projects to ensure that the team's overall resources are used effectively and that project deadlines are met.
  • Ensures financial integrity of selling transactions, including but not limited to: managing pricing accuracy and booking, forecasting of secured projects, and compliance with applicable policy and procedure.
  • Engage necessary departments, the factory and/or vendors to resolve operational problems and minimize delays, including evaluating and authorizing changes that significantly impact the scope, budget, or timeline of the project.
  • Measures, analyzes, and presents annual revenue and gross margin forecasts as well as year-to-date updates on performance, monthly close P&L, booking and shipments, commission statements, and backlog summaries.
  • Ensures all established processes are met. Periodically reviews operations to maintain continuous improvement, as well as identifying and resolving operational problems to ensure minimum costs and prevent operational delays.
  • Using direct and indirect supervision, monitors and develops Project Engineering (PE) staff, preparing quarterly reviews to ensure each PE is on track to meet or exceed goals. Creates and monitors performance development plans as necessary.
  • Trains and ensures all assigned employees are aware of and comply with company, government and customer policies, procedures and regulations.

Qualifications:

Must have:

  • Bachelors degree in a related field
  • 5+ years of related experience and/or training
  • 3+ years of team management experience
  • Prior experience within the commercial HVAC industry

The typical annual base salary for this position ranges from $135,000 - $150,000 plus annual bonus plan in New Jersey. The range displayed represents the pay range for all positions in the job grade which this position falls. Individual base pay will depend on a wide range of factors including your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.
